diff --git a/arch/m68k/Kconfig.machine b/arch/m68k/Kconfig.machine
index 17e8c3a292d7..1851c66e8667 100644
--- a/arch/m68k/Kconfig.machine
+++ b/arch/m68k/Kconfig.machine
@@ -136,14 +136,13 @@ config SUN3

         If you don't want to compile a kernel exclusively for a Sun 3, say N.

-endif # M68KCLASSIC
-
   config PILOT
       bool

   config PILOT3
       bool "Pilot 1000/5000, PalmPilot Personal/Pro, or PalmIII support"
-     depends on M68328
+     depends on !MMU
+     select M68328

Given that M68328 depends on !MMU do you also need or want that here?

Yes, that is exactly the reason: if M68328 depends on !MMU and gets
selected by something that lacks the !MMU dependency, we'd get a
Kconfig warning and a failed build when enabling PILOT3 with MMU
enabled.
